Origins of the Tale

The Elves and the Shoemaker is a classic German folktale collected by the Grimm Brothers‚ featuring magical elves who help a struggling shoemaker‚ blending folklore with timeless charm.

The Grimm Brothers and Their Folktales

The Grimm Brothers‚ Jacob and Wilhelm‚ were renowned German scholars who collected and published folktales in the early 19th century‚ preserving European cultural heritage.

Their compilation included The Elves and the Shoemaker‚ a story reflecting the brothers’ emphasis on moral lessons‚ hard work‚ and the supernatural‚ common in their narratives.

The tale exemplifies the Grimm Brothers’ ability to capture the essence of folklore‚ blending magic with everyday life to create enduring stories for generations of readers worldwide.

Plot Summary

A poor shoemaker‚ struggling to make ends meet‚ receives magical help from elves who craft exquisite shoes overnight‚ transforming his life and fortunes.

The story‚ available in PDF‚ highlights kindness‚ gratitude‚ and the power of good deeds‚ leaving a lasting moral lesson for readers of all ages.

The Struggles of the Shoemaker

The shoemaker‚ a kind and hardworking man‚ faced immense poverty despite his honesty. He and his wife worked tirelessly‚ but their efforts barely provided enough to survive. With only a small amount of leather left‚ their situation grew desperate. The shoemaker’s dedication to his craft was evident‚ yet his struggles deepened as he could not earn enough to improve his life. This bleak reality underscored the challenges of his humble existence‚ setting the stage for the magical intervention that would soon change his fortunes. The Arrival of the Elves and Their Help

One night‚ a group of kind elves discovered the shoemaker’s struggles and decided to help. They secretly entered his workshop‚ using the leftover leather to craft exquisite shoes. By morning‚ the elves had vanished‚ leaving behind perfectly made footwear. This miraculous assistance repeated each night‚ transforming the shoemaker’s fortunes. His shop became renowned for the exceptional quality of the shoes‚ attracting many customers. The elves’ selfless acts of kindness brought prosperity to the shoemaker and his wife‚ highlighting the power of generosity and hard work. The Shoemaker’s Gratitude and the Elves’ Departure

Deeply moved by the elves’ kindness‚ the shoemaker and his wife prepared gifts to thank them. However‚ the elves‚ wishing to remain anonymous‚ vanished upon discovering the offerings. Despite their departure‚ the shoemaker’s life was forever changed. His business thrived‚ and he never forgot the elves’ generosity.
